Treadmills

Treadmills are one of the most popular pieces of cardio equipment found in fitness facilities. They provide a versatile and effective way for users to engage in aerobic exercise, whether it be walking, jogging, or running. When choosing treadmills for your facility, consider factors such as maximum weight capacity, speed range, incline options, and cushioning to ensure that you offer a comfortable and safe workout environment for your clients.

Key features to look for in commercial treadmills:

  • High weight capacity to accommodate a wide range of users
  • Variable speed settings for users of all fitness levels
  • Adjustable incline options to simulate different terrains
  • Advanced cushioning systems to reduce impact on joints
  • Durable construction to withstand heavy usage

Elliptical Trainers

Elliptical trainers are low-impact cardio machines that provide a full-body workout by targeting the arms, legs, and core muscles. They are a popular choice for users looking to improve cardiovascular fitness while minimizing stress on the joints. When selecting elliptical trainers for your facility, look for models with adjustable resistance levels, preset workout programs, and ergonomic design features to enhance user comfort and experience.

Key features to look for in commercial elliptical trainers:

  • Adjustable resistance levels for customized workouts
  • Preset workout programs to keep users engaged
  • Ergonomic handlebars and foot pedals for comfort
  • Heart rate monitoring capabilities for tracking fitness progress
  • Compact footprint to maximize space efficiency

Strength Training Equipment

Strength training equipment is essential for building muscle, improving bone density, and increasing overall strength. From free weights to machines, there are various options to choose from based on the needs of your clientele. Consider including a mix of equipment such as power racks, weight benches, cable machines, and functional trainers to provide a comprehensive strength training experience for your clients.

Key strength training equipment for commercial facilities:

  • Power racks for versatile barbell exercises
  • Weight benches for chest press, shoulder press, and more
  • Cable machines for targeted muscle isolation
  • Functional trainers for dynamic movements and core stability
  • Dumbbells and kettlebells for free weight exercises

Functional Training Equipment

Functional training equipment focuses on movements that mimic daily activities and sports-specific actions. It helps improve balance, coordination, and stability while engaging multiple muscle groups simultaneously. Incorporating functional training equipment such as stability balls, resistance bands, and agility ladders can add diversity to your facility's workout offerings and cater to clients looking for a dynamic and challenging workout experience.

Key functional training equipment for commercial facilities:

  • Stability balls for core and balance exercises
  • Resistance bands for strength training and flexibility
  • Agility ladders for speed and coordination drills
  • Battle ropes for cardiovascular and strength workouts
  • Suspension trainers for bodyweight exercises
